在搭建一个网站时,服务器的配置不仅关乎网站的性能和稳定性,还直接影响到SEO(搜索引擎优化)效果。一个优化良好的服务器能够提升网站的加载速度、保障网站的可访问性,并为搜索引擎提供清晰的数据结构。本文将介绍如何配置服务器以增强网站的SEO友好性,从服务器选择到优化设置的每一个细节,帮助你打造一个符合SEO要求的网络环境。
选择合适的服务器类型
服务器的选择对于SEO至关重要。不同类型的服务器对网站的加载速度、稳定性和安全性有直接影响,这些因素都会影响搜索引擎的排名。根据网站的规模和需求,可以选择以下几种常见的服务器类型:
共享主机:共享主机是多个用户共享同一台服务器资源,这通常是小型个人网站的首选。尽管价格低廉,但共享资源可能导致性能不稳定,这对SEO不利。搜索引擎倾向于优先排名加载速度快且稳定的网站,因此对于流量较小的博客或个人项目,使用共享主机仍然可以满足基本需求。
VPS(虚拟专用服务器):VPS为用户提供了更多的资源和控制权,适合中型网站或需要更多灵活性的网站。VPS能够提供比共享主机更高的性能,避免了其他用户的干扰,因此在SEO方面更加友好。
独立服务器:对于大型网站或流量较高的网站,独立服务器提供了最大的控制权和最好的性能。虽然成本较高,但它能确保网站在访问量大的情况下依然稳定运行,并提供更高的SEO友好性。
云服务器:随着云计算的发展,云服务器因其弹性扩展的特点越来越受欢迎。云服务器能够根据流量需求进行自动扩展,有效避免流量波动对网站性能的影响,对SEO也有积极作用。
选择适合自己需求的服务器类型,有助于为网站提供稳定的基础,有利于提高搜索引擎排名。
优化服务器响应速度
网站加载速度是搜索引擎排名的重要因素之一。服务器的响应速度直接影响到网站的加载时间,进而影响用户体验和SEO排名。以下是几种优化服务器响应速度的方式:
使用CDN(内容分发网络):CDN可以通过将网站内容缓存到多个全球节点,提高网站在不同地区的访问速度。对于有国际流量的站点,CDN可以显著缩短页面加载时间。
启用HTTP/2或HTTP/3协议:现代的HTTP协议,如HTTP/2和HTTP/3,相比于旧的HTTP/1.1,具有更高的效率和更低的延迟。它们支持多路复用和更快速的资源传输,可以加速网站的加载速度。
启用Gzip压缩:Gzip是一种常见的压缩技术,可以减少网站文件的大小,从而提高网站的加载速度。在服务器端启用Gzip压缩后,浏览器会下载压缩后的文件,减小带宽占用,提高网站性能。
优化数据库性能:如果你的服务器是动态内容网站(如基于WordPress、Joomla等系统搭建的站点),数据库查询优化是提高响应速度的关键。可以通过缓存数据库查询结果、定期清理数据库以及优化索引来减少服务器负担。
确保服务器快速响应,可以显著提升网站的SEO表现。
提高网站的稳定性和安全性
网站的稳定性和安全性不仅对用户体验至关重要,也是搜索引擎评估网站质量的重要标准。搜索引擎会优先推荐稳定且安全的网站,避免那些频繁崩溃或被攻击的网站。以下是一些优化服务器稳定性和安全性的方法:
定期备份:确保网站的数据和文件定期备份,以防止数据丢失。在发生服务器故障或被黑客攻击时,能够迅速恢复网站,避免停机影响SEO。
使用SSL证书:Google等搜索引擎已经明确表示,启用HTTPS会作为排名因素之一。确保你的服务器配置SSL证书,将网站升级为HTTPS,可以提高用户信任度并增加SEO分数。
防火墙和DDoS防护:使用防火墙和DDoS防护可以保护你的服务器免受恶意攻击。定期更新防火墙规则,监控流量变化,能够减少因安全问题导致的停机和SEO惩罚。
服务器监控和日志分析:通过监控服务器的性能和分析访问日志,可以及时发现潜在的问题,并采取有效措施避免这些问题对网站SEO产生不利影响。
一个安全、稳定的网站环境能确保用户和搜索引擎的良好体验,是提升SEO的基础。
配置友好的URL和目录结构
服务器的配置还包括URL和目录结构的优化。一个清晰、易懂的URL结构不仅对用户友好,且有助于搜索引擎的爬虫更好地抓取和理解网站内容。
使用简洁且描述性强的URL:URL中应包含有意义的关键词,避免使用无意义的数字或符号。例如,www.example.com/seo-friendly-tips比www.example.com/page?id=123更符合SEO优化要求。
避免重复内容和规范化:服务器配置需要避免重复内容问题,确保搜索引擎能够正确索引页面。通过使用rel="canonical"标签可以告诉搜索引擎哪个页面是主要版本,从而避免因多个页面显示相同内容而影响SEO。
合理的目录结构:清晰的目录结构有助于搜索引擎更好地理解网站的层级关系,也使得用户能更方便地导航。确保每个页面都能通过少数点击就到达,避免过于复杂的目录层级。
清晰的URL和目录结构不仅提升用户体验,也有助于SEO优化。
设置合适的缓存机制
缓存机制对于提升网站的加载速度至关重要,而加载速度与SEO直接挂钩。服务器缓存可以减少不必要的重复请求,提升页面的响应时间。
启用页面缓存:通过启用服务器端的页面缓存,可以减少每次访问时需要重新生成页面的时间,提高用户体验和搜索引擎的抓取速度。
利用浏览器缓存:配置服务器以缓存静态资源(如图片、JavaScript、CSS文件等),让浏览器在用户再次访问时可以快速加载,而无需重新请求服务器。
Object Cache(对象缓存):适用于动态内容的网站,减少数据库查询,提高响应速度。通过Redis、Memcached等缓存机制,可以有效减少服务器负担,提升性能。
优化缓存策略是提高SEO友好性的一项关键措施。
结语
在网站的搭建过程中,服务器配置对SEO的影响不可忽视。选择合适的服务器类型、优化响应速度、确保安全性与稳定性、配置友好的URL和目录结构以及设置有效的缓存机制,都是提升SEO友好性的重要步骤。通过合理的服务器优化,不仅可以提升网站的加载速度和安全性,还能为搜索引擎提供一个更清晰、易于抓取的结构,从而提高网站的排名和流量。